Output 3542cde4607976292e978a40f02b718b8371cd45fe6a52f932fa21fed5732228:77

value
112890
script pubkey
OP_0 OP_PUSHBYTES_20 f12e59e596ae2a073ea9003afac87aab0d67953e
address
bc1q7yh9nevk4c4qw04fqqa04jr64vxk09f73usld4
transaction
3542cde4607976292e978a40f02b718b8371cd45fe6a52f932fa21fed5732228
confirmations
109484
spent
true